const classcamRubyPlugin::RubyPlugin

sys::Obj
  camembert::BasicPlugin
    camRubyPlugin::RubyPlugin

RubyPlugin

_name

Source

const static Str _name := "Ruby"

cmds

Source

const PluginCommands cmds

commands

Source

virtual override PluginCommands? commands()

docProv

Source

const RubyDocs docProv := RubyDocs.<ctor>()

docProvider

Source

virtual override PluginDocs? docProvider()

envType

Source

virtual override Type? envType()

icon

Source

virtual const override Image icon := ...

isProject

Source

virtual override Bool isProject(File dir)

make

Source

new make()

name

Source

virtual const override Str name := _name

onInit

Source

virtual override Void onInit(File configDir)

prjName

Source

virtual override Str prjName(File prjDir)